Actually there were a few atempts to replace SMTP. Possibly the most notable one is DJB's Internet Mail 2000 ( http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Internet_Mail_2000). But as you said - so far it looks like it's too late and anything that will be suggested in the future will have to accomodate for SMTP servers at least for a very long transitional period, which will keep this "back door" always open at least up to a degree :-(. --Amos
